Newlywed Trip Inquiries Increase by 35%... Lotte Hotel Jeju Sells Honeymoon Packages View original image

[Asia Economy Reporter Cha Min-young] As the novel coronavirus infection (COVID-19) spreads worldwide, various hotel package products are being offered for newlyweds whose honeymoon plans have been disrupted.


Lotte Hotel Jeju announced on the 2nd that it will sell the ‘My Wedding Day’ package, consisting of various events for newlyweds, until June 30.

A representative of Lotte Hotel Jeju said, “The number of inquiries from honeymoon travelers has increased by about 35% compared to the end of February,” adding, “As the weather began to warm up in April, inquiries surged, so the honeymoon package period, originally scheduled to end in late April, has been extended until June, and additional benefits reflecting new customer needs have been added.”
